New Trier Township has the good fortune to have boundaries that include four different state legislative districts, two state senatorial districts and two U.S. Congressional Districts. This means that we are represented by, and our voices have an impact on, six members of the State legislature and two members of Congress.
Wilmette, (pop. 27,600+) is the village with the most New Trier registered voters and precincts -- 25. Spanning two congressional districts, Wilmette is the only New Trier community that has two U.S. Representatives, Jan Schakowsky D. 9th Cong. Dist., and Mark Kirk R. 10th Cong. Dist. Wilmette also spans two state legislative districts, the 17th, Beth Coulson R., and the 18th, Robyn Gabel D. One state senatorial district, the 9th covers all of Wilmette and is represented by State Senator Jeff Schoenberg.
Winnetka (pop.12,400+) has 12 precincts and spans two state legislative districts, the 17th, Beth Coulson R., and the 18th, Robyn Gabel D. One state senatorial district, the 9th covers all of Winnetka and is represented by State Senator Jeff Schoenberg. The village is presently represented in Congress by Mark Kirk R. 10th Cong. Dist.
Glencoe (pop. 8,700+) has 9 precincts and spans three state legislative districts, with 7 1/2 precincts in the 58th, Karen May D., 1/2 precinct (part of pct 7) in the 18th, Robyn Gabel D., and 1 precinct (pct. 6) in the 17th, Beth Coulson R. The village also spans two senatorial districts with 7 1/2 precincts in the 29th district represented by State Senator Susan Garrett and 1 1/2 precincts in the 9th district represented by State Senator Jeff Schoenberg. Mark Kirk is presently the U.S. Congressman for the 10th Cong.
Three precincts in the southwestern part of New Trier are within the Glenview village boundary. These precincts are represented by Beth Coulson R. 17th Legis. Dist., State Senator Jeff Schoenberg D. 9th State Senate Dist. and Mark Kirk R. 10th Cong. Dist.
Two precincts in the western part of New Trier are within the Northfield village boundary. These precincts are represented by Beth Coulson R. 17th Legis. Dist., State Senator Jeff Schoenberg D. 9th State Senate Dist. and Mark Kirk R. 10th Cong. Dist.
Kenilworth (pop. 2,500+) is the smallest village completely within New Trier Township. The community houses the New Trier Republican Party headquarters. The village has 2 precincts. Kenilworth is presently represented in Congress by Mark Kirk R. 10th Cong. Dist. and in the Illinois House by Robyn Gabel D. 18th Legis. Dist. Kenilworth's state senator is Jeff Schoenberg, 9th State Senate Dist.
